Komatsu Forklift U.S.A. markets, sells, and provides aftermarket support for Komatsu branded forklifts in the United States, Canada, Mexico, and Latin American countries. Komatsu forklifts are sold and serviced by a dedicated dealership network with over 200 locations within the regions they serve.

Yale Materials Handling Corporation markets a full line of materials handling lift truck products and services, including electric, gas, LP-gas and diesel powered lift trucks; narrow aisle, very narrow aisle and motorized hand trucks. Yale has a comprehensive service offering including Yale Vision wireless asset management, fleet management, Yale service, parts, financing and training.
